Mohamed A. Jaffer has authored 22 papers that have received a total of 611 indexed citations.
This includes 8 papers in Epidemiology, 5 papers in Molecular Biology and 5 papers in Plant Science. The topics of these papers are Poxvirus research and outbreaks (3 papers),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(2 papers) and Virus-based gene therapy research (2 papers). Mohamed A. Jaffer is often cited by papers focused on Poxvirus research and outbreaks (3 papers),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(2 papers) and Virus-based gene therapy research (2 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in South Africa, United States and United Kingdom. Mohamed A. Jaffer's co-authors include Arvind Varsani, B.T. Sewell, Anna‐Lise Williamson, Edward P. Rybicki and M. B. von Wechmar and has published in prestigious journals such as Biochemistry, Biochemical Journal and Scientific Reports.
